ABB AO820

The ABB AO820 is a versatile analog output module designed for seamless integration with ABB’s AC 800M and AC 800XA distributed control systems, enabling precise signal conversion and control command execution for industrial field devices. Equipped with 8 independent output channels, the ABB AO820 supports a wide range of standard analog signals, making it ideal for regulating valves, variable frequency drives (VFDs), and other actuators in process automation. Engineered with industrial-grade durability, the ABB AO820 operates reliably in harsh environments with extreme temperatures, high vibration, and strong electromagnetic interference, ensuring uninterrupted performance in critical production processes. This module serves as a key link between the control system and field equipment, translating digital control signals into accurate analog outputs to maintain optimal process parameters and boost production efficiency.

Product Parameters

Parameter Category Specifications
Output Channels 8 independent analog outputs
Supported Signal Ranges 4–20 mA, 0–20 mA, 0–10 V, ±5 V, ±10 V (configurable per channel)
Output Accuracy ±0.1% of full scale (at 25°C); ±0.3% over operating temperature range
Resolution 16 bits
Isolation Rating Channel-to-system: 1500 V AC; Channel-to-channel: 500 V AC
Operating Temperature -40°C to +70°C
Power Supply 24 V DC (18–32 V DC)
Communication Protocol PROFIBUS DP, MODBUS TCP (via host controller)
Dimensions (W×H×D) 25 mm × 210 mm × 120 mm
Certifications CE, UL, ATEX, IECEx, CSA

Advantages and Features

  1. Precision Output Control

    The ABB AO820 delivers 16-bit resolution and ±0.1% full-scale accuracy, ensuring that control signals sent to field actuators are highly consistent and reliable. This precision is critical for applications such as flow rate regulation and pressure control, where even minor signal deviations can impact product quality.

  2. Flexible Channel Configuration

    Each channel of the ABB AO820 can be independently programmed for different signal types, eliminating the need for multiple specialized modules and reducing system complexity. The module supports both current and voltage outputs, making it compatible with a broad range of industrial actuators.

  3. Rugged Design for Harsh Environments

    Built with a corrosion-resistant housing and wide operating temperature range, the ABB AO820 thrives in demanding industries like oil and gas, chemical processing, and power generation. Its high isolation ratings protect the module and host controller from voltage surges and ground loops.

  4. Hot-Swap Capability for Minimized Downtime

    The ABB AO820 supports hot swapping, allowing maintenance personnel to replace or upgrade the module without shutting down the entire control system. This feature significantly reduces production downtime and improves overall plant availability.

Application Cases in Application Fields

  1. Chemical Processing Industry

    In a large-scale chemical plant, the ABB AO820 is used to control the opening degree of control valves in reactor feed lines. Its precise output signals ensure accurate dosing of raw materials, maintaining consistent reaction conditions and reducing waste. The module’s anti-interference design withstands the high EMI generated by nearby pumps and motors.

  2. HVAC and Building Automation

    A commercial building automation system deploys the ABB AO820 to regulate variable air volume (VAV) boxes and chilled water valves. The module’s flexible channel configuration allows it to output both 4–20 mA signals for valve control and 0–10 V signals for fan speed adjustment, simplifying system design.

  3. Water and Wastewater Treatment

    A municipal wastewater treatment plant uses the ABB AO820 to control sludge pumps and aeration blowers. The module’s rugged construction resists the humid and corrosive environment of the treatment facility, while its high accuracy ensures optimal aeration levels for efficient biological treatment processes.

Selection Suggestions and Precautions

Selection Suggestions

  1. Choose the ABB AO820 for projects requiring 8-channel analog output with mixed signal types (current + voltage), especially in harsh industrial environments.
  2. Verify compatibility with your existing ABB AC 800M/800XA control system; for third-party controllers, confirm support for PROFIBUS DP or MODBUS TCP protocols.
  3. Calculate the number of modules needed based on the total number of actuators, leveraging the module’s high channel density to minimize equipment and installation costs.

Precautions

  1. Ensure proper wiring and grounding during installation to maximize the ABB AO820’s performance and prevent signal distortion.
  2. Do not exceed the module’s specified output current and voltage limits, as this may damage the module or connected field devices.
  3. Follow ABB’s official guidelines when performing hot swapping to avoid communication disruptions or system errors.
  4. Conduct regular calibration (every 6–12 months) to maintain the module’s output accuracy, especially in high-precision control applications.
